In this edition, we introduce a new “Spotlight” series highlighting units that are shaping the future of communications and information systems across the Royal Corps of Signals. It is fitting that we begin with 255 (Special Operations) Signal Squadron — one of the most dynamic and rapidly evolving capabilities within the Corps.
Formed through a period of profound transformation, 255 Signal Squadron exemplifies the shift from traditional field communications to agile, data-enabled support for Special Operations. Operating at high readiness and often in complex, contested environments, the Squadron has embraced innovation, integration, and a culture of continuous learning to deliver operational advantage at pace.
As the Corps adapts to meet the demands of modern warfare, 255 Signal Squadron offers a compelling insight into how people, technology, and mindset combine to redefine what Signals can achieve. This article captures a unit not only meeting today’s challenges, but actively shaping tomorrow’s capability.
